AVX Ultra Low ESR 0603 series

AVX U Series Ceramic capacitors have ultra-low equivalent series resistance (ESR) at VHF, UHF, and microwave frequencies. These capacitors provide tight tolerances as well as C0G (NP0) characteristics and voltage variation. Capacitance 1.0 pF to 100 pF at 1 MHz
